Did you know you can save time and money by having freight shipped directly from any point of origin to the customer’s location?  The advantage of this approach, called cross trading, is that the usual middle step (shipment to your location) is skipped.

For example, assume the point of origin is in China, your warehouse is in Toronto, and your customer is in Chicago.  With cross trading, the freight would go directly from China to Chicago, leading to savings in terms of transit time and freight costs.

Act Quickly to resolve non-compliance issues and avoid increasing fines

Most monetary penalties issued by the Canada Border Services Agency (CBSA) under the Administrative Monetary Penalty System (AMPS) escalate with repetition.
